Serializing data structures in c software engineering stack. In sfdiagram, datacontractserializer is used for serialization. Hi, i have a pdf which has some data and i want to serialize that pdf into some encoded format. If the database was in a consistent state before the execution of a transaction, it must remain consistent after the execution of the transaction as well. Serialization is executed by common language runtime clr to save an objects current state information to a temporary like asp. First normal form this rule defines that all the attributes in a relation must have atomic domains.
To serialize the object, you need to apply serializableattribute. Serialization and deserialization in java core java. Generate pdf file from database through a button click on webpage answered rss 6 replies last post sep 26, 20 04. Mar 22, 2015 database isolation levels and serialization for transactions. Its what allows us to store objects on disk and reconstruct them in memory when necessary perhaps. Serialize and deserialize objects glossary item box this documentation article is a legacy resource describing the functionality of the deprecated openaccess classic only. It relates to the isolation property of a database transaction. If a null value is passed to the serializer, a nullpointerexception will be thrown. How to read the data from a properties file in java.
Exercises due after class make sure youve downloaded and run the. Assigning the target property to another variable creates a strong reference. Why i cant retrieve a database field havin point as data type using hibernate5\spring data jpa into this spring boot project. Database tutorial tutorials for database and associated technologies including memcached, neo4j, imsdb, db2, redis, mongodb, sql, mysql, plsql, sqlite, postgresql. The book about memory briefly discussed the topic of serializing data structures for the purposes of storing it to disk, or sending it across a network. Why i cant retrieve a database field havin point as data. Serialization security bugs explained daniel miessler.
Generate pdf file from database through a button click on. Ive recently read three separate books on algorithms and data structures, tcpip socket programming, and programming with memory. Dec 17, 2019 daniel miessler is a cybersecurity expert and author of the real internet of things, based in san francisco, california. Such streams can be stored in a database,as a file or memory. The different modes of introduction provide information about how and when this weakness may be introduced. Serialization in wpf diagram sfdiagram serialization is the process of converting the state of sfdiagrams objects into a stream of bytes to recreate them when needed. Java 8 object oriented programming programming after a serialized object has been written into a file, it can be read from the file and deserialized that is, the type information and bytes that represent the object and its data can be used to recreate the object in memory. Nov 05, 20 one thought on java serialization of data types rajeswari k may 4, 2015 at 2. Serialization is the process of converting an object into a stream of bytes which is easily transferable over the network and storing its current state on any permanent storage media like file or database for later use. Sep, 2016 serializability is closely related to concurrency how do different concurrent processessessionstransactions serialize or synchronize their respective access to. The reverse operation of serialization is called deserialization where bytestream is converted into an object. Serializability of a schedule means equivalence in the outcome, the database state, data values to a serial schedule i.
Serialization is a process of storing state of an object to some media like disk file or stream. For pacman alone, for example, you will have to have a table storing positions of all the uneaten pellets, bonuses, positions and current state of ghosts. Normalization is a method to remove all these anomalies and bring the database to a consistent state. Net provides a bridge between the front end controls and the back end database. The reverse process of serialization is called deserialization. The phase identifies a point in the life cycle at which introduction may occur, while the note provides a typical scenario related to introduction during the given phase. M is the size of the buffer p, which might be larger than n. In computing, serialization or serialisation is the process of translating data structures or object state into a format that can be stored for example, in a file or memory buffer or transmitted for example, across a network connection link and reconstructed later possibly in a different computer environment.
Serialize and deserialize complex json javascript the. Create an excel file with needed data for printing. Netconnection objectstructured query languagecommand and datareader objectscommand object to insert, delete, and update dataadapter and dataset objects. You can use the isalive property to check if the reference is valid, and the target property to get a reference to the actual object. The database should be durable enough to hold all its latest updates even if the system fails or restarts. How to create a thread without implementing the runnable interface in java. But if i take point and pen object in simple class without linked list, i can not serialize instance of point and pen. Since the table can be computed, theres no point in serializing it. Net objects encapsulate all the data access operations and the controls interact with these objects to display data, thus hiding the details of movement of data. Gs1 general specifications standard to agree to grant to gs1 members a royalty free licence or a rand licence to necessary claim s, as that term is defined in the gs1 ip policy.
The reverse process of creating object from sequence of bytes is called deserialization. To create a weakly referenced object, pass the name of the object to the weakreference constructor. Serialization is a process of converting an object into a sequence of bytes which can be persisted to a disk or database or can be sent through streams. Programmers guide openaccess orm classic old api openaccess tasks working with objects how to. I know that i want create few tables and use select command but is too slowly for me select for fill arraylists is too slow i want get object use sqlreader and i cant user cant change objects in database. An implementation guide 5 meanwhile, illicit prescriptiondrug dealers ranging from organized gangs, to corrupt doctors, to teens raiding their parents medicine cabinets are fueling an epidemic in prescription opioid addiction. In my serialization the deserializer can work behind network connection so it cant count on reflection mechanism. Copy link quote reply harelm commented mar 19, 2017. Serialization in java is a mechanism of writing the state of an object into a bytestream. I am using custom linked list, where i can able to serialize instance of pen, point etc. A class must implement serializable interface present in java.
Abuse of narcotic painkillers, such as oxycontin, percocet. That is,the first readobject myt retrieve the integer object stored rather than the date object. If a transaction updates a chunk of data in a database and commits, then the database will hold the modified data. Specializing in reconosint, application and iot security, and security program design, he has 20 years of experience helping companies from earlystage startups to the global 100. The serializer also stores the strings size, allowing it to be used as a groupserializer in btreemaps. Few weeks back we saw how to serialize objects to disk file in binary format. Pdf object serialization and deserialization using xml. Net and serializing only base class properties ithoughts. A comprehensive, searchable multimedia source for recorded webinars, guidelines, standards, case studies, white papers, and related documentation. Hi sir, in the above implicit serialization example,when youread the integer,vector objects using ois.
In databases, serializability means that the database behave with concurrent transaction as if they were serialized, as if concurrent transaction have been executed one after one. Serializability is a property of a transaction schedule history. Serialization is the process of converting the state information of an object instance into a binary or textual form to persist into storage medium or transported over a network. Every deserializer needs information about types the data structure. Serialization is internally used in remote applications. Ensure that row 1 in your data file is the headers, or field names of your columns. It works fine if i use the following code and there is no geo query. Pdf interoperability of potentially heterogeneous databases has been an ongoing research issue for a number of years in the database community. Java provides a mechanism, called object serialization where an object can be represented as a sequence of bytes that includes the objects data as well as information about the objects type and the types of data stored in the object.
350 1049 1006 1287 77 62 66 731 1166 961 1300 1007 463 1203 566 89 473 396 221 65 345 704 1140 1363 839 113 1385 1248 447 19 148 530 344 475 1384 1169 118 105 1257 1138